    Banker was worth every penny of the $40 CAD I spent on the crown pack to get him.

    I'm a relatively new player with a full roster of low-level toons - each of them have a backpack the size of a scrib's brain. I want to be able to enjoy PvE content without having to leave the delve every five minutes, teleport home, find a bank, then use a wayshrine to return to the delve and become encumbered all over again. I waste hours of my real life as a shameless Elder Scrolls hoarder, all for the glory of my Crafting toon, who naps in Vivec City waiting for materials to roll in.

    With the banker, I can delve, dump, and continue. No log-out-log-in game, waiting for the next ESO+ trial for a taste of that sweet sweet crafting bag. One $40 purchase, and I'm set.

    That said, I have some suggestions for ZOS to make some improvements:

    1. Allow us to at least re-name the guy, if not change his appearance/race/sex. One of my toons is a classic Nord racist and doesn't cotton to no dark elf glaring over his shoulders with his buggy red eyes. Shor's bones! But if he must look and sound as he does, can I at least re-name him as to make him my dunmer toon's friendly uncle Dalmir?
    2. Many have said it before, but access to the guild bank would be much appreciated. I can see why they didn't include the Guild Store, because it gives players who bought the banker instant access to pretty much everything in the game, provided they joined the right trading guild. ESO goes out of its way to avoid the pay-to-win model and I appreciate it, but the Guild Banks can't be exploited any more than the in-game mail system can.
    3. Good lord, this is over twice as expensive as the Dark Brotherhood DLC. I know I said the banker was worth it, but when I had to make that decision in the Crown Store, I died a little inside.

    Hope this helps. If you're a new player, buying the banker will save you a lot of hassle in the middle of a dungeon, so I say it's worth it.
